Final Fantasy 7 Director Kept ‘Open World Fatigue’ in Mind as New Remake Chapter Promises ‘Bigger’ World Than Rebirth

Final Fantasy 7 Revelation director Naoki Hamaguchi has acknowledged the “open world fatigue” affecting the industry but says Square Enix was “very careful” to make sure fans would have “all the guidance they need” in the new remake chapter – even if it’s bigger than the last.

The developer helping lead the finale to its 2027 launch spoke about its size during a conversation with Eurogamer. In the interview, he teased how the team has done its best to tie a bow on the trilogy with one final adventure for Cloud, Tifa, Barret, and the rest of the gang in their fight against Sephiroth.

The two previous installments in the remake trilogy – Final Fantasy 7 Remake and Rebirth – have been lumped into online conversations about enormous open worlds that sometimes overstay their welcome. Hamaguchi said the concept of open world fatigue is “very important” to him, but it sounds like players won’t need to worry about feeling too lost.

“There are a lot of open world games out in the world right now, and [the idea of ‘open world fatigue’] is a very important concept to me,” he replied when Eurogamer asked about feedback to Rebirth. “It depends on personal preference and different perceptions, but for me personally, I know I’ve had the experience where I’ve been thrown out into an open world game and not known where to go, not known where to begin, and not known what to do. But at the same time, the concept of being thrown into this wondrous world where anything goes is amazing.”

There are certainly players who would prefer to get lost in a vibrant fantasy universe. In a world promising to be as packed as Final Fantasy 7 Revelation, that idea might be especially enticing. Hamaguchi said that, as a creator, he believes it’s important to “offer proper guidance” in open-world games so that players “know what to do, and know where to go.”

“In Final Fantasy VII Rebirth, we made sure to make it easy for the players to understand how much content there is, and how difficult that content is,” he added. “That design philosophy is applied to Revelation: players have all the guidance that they need. This is something that both myself and the development team were very careful about when we designed the game.”

It seems Hamaguchi and the rest of the development team wanted to strike a balance when it came to guidance in Final Fantasy 7 Revelation. One example he mentioned involved asking players to rely on their memory to make sure they land in their desired location when dropping from the Highwind airship.

“That’s another example of the guidance we’re giving players, without directing them too much,” Hamaguchi continued. “The world is even bigger than it was in Rebirth, so it is more important than ever for us to ensure there’s enough guidance here, so people have no issues enjoying what this game has to offer.”

Final Fantasy 7 Revelation currently has no firm release date but is expected to launch for PC, Nintendo Switch 2,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X | S in spring 2027.
